Based on the project which my research institute cooperate with the Yankuang Group, we do the research on auxiliary transport of coal mine, especially in the coal mines of Yankuang Goup. We built the mathematic model with the method of systems engineering, and analyzed the model by Interpretative Structural Modeling with experts on coal mine auxiliary transport. The problem were summarized, some methods were raised by experts, these methods can do help to mine auxiliary transport. The proposal made by the experts in this project of Yankuang Group can be consulted by the other building coal mines.When the price of coal were low and the cost of labor were also lower than nowadays, most of the coal mines which are operating now were built. Too many factors cause the auxiliary transport were made up by winches, and there were too many labors work on it. Too much time cost and the costs also risen up as the wages which paid to the miners. In order to change this situation, conventional rail driven were designed by our institute and the Yankuang Group together. Conventional rail driven was driven by wire and rolled on the rail, can operate on complex situations and in long distance. Popular 3D designing-software were used in the designing process, models were simulated in computer before the driven were manufactured. New design software and advanced conception were also used in the designing process.
